> I just changed my fuel filters and bled my fuel system of air yesterday.
>
> Im not sure what the plastic screw is, I was wondering the same thing... The bolt is the bleed vent.
>
> I replaced my filter with the Racor R20U filter. This is also a 10 micron filter. My boat came with a 10 micron filter as well.
>
> The mechanic at the local Yanmar distributor said that given the small fuel usages rates of these small sailboat engines, you could use a primary filter down to the 2 micron size, although it would be overkill since the engine mounted secondary fuel filter is 2 microns.
>
> Anyway, I just changed mine, bled the air from the system using the Racor filter housing hand operated fueld priming pump, and all is well now.

>> What is the nylon slotted screw on the top of the fuel filter housing for? I
>> can't remember whether this is the bleed screw or the bolt is the bleed vent.
>> Also, Yanmar recommends that the primary filter be 30 u but mine boat came with
>> a 10 u filter. No problems with the 10 but just curious since the fuel rate is
>> listed a different in the Racor informtion.
